Well lately when I've been working out I find myself feeling weak and out of energy after the first set of an exercise. I can only assume it's due to eating habits.

I've been trying to not only gain muscle, but also lose weight in the past little bit so I've tried to tone down on the intake and eat healthier. I think I may be having a lack of protein(just recently started to eat a can of tuna/salmon/etc. for lunch and a protein bar after the workout)would adding in a protein shake to each meal help?

day basically is this, in terms of eating.

7:30 - Oatmeal, coffee, toast.

11:00 - Can of tuna, fruit, water.

3:00 - Workout.

4:30 - Protein bar, V8 Splash or water.

6:00 - Veggies, some sort of meat, water.

Snack - Fruit and water. Coffee sometimes.

What can I add to make it better for me? I'm 155 lbs right now, . I'm always strapped for time so that's why I tend to have few, short meals.

You absolutely need to eat more carbohydrates, they are the body's preferred source of fuel. You are correct, your diet is the problem here. You are glycogen depleted and most likely not eating adequate calories so you can't perform at your full capacity. You will not gain muscle without eating enough and your body will catabolize (breakdown) muscle which is the opposite of what you want.
